Web10 Dec 2024 · According to CaveDivers.com.au, 368 cave divers died between 1969 and 2007. Cave diving is for the most adventurous of scuba divers. For those who are willing to push boundaries to the absolute limits. It’s technical diving at its most technical. When things get more technical, more accidents happen. WebCave diving is unironically one of the most dangerous things a human can engage in. The problem is that the cave looks open, beautiful, safe, inviting. But when you swim through, your fins kick up the fine silt that settles on the cave floor. Soon the water behind you is completely opaque, and you don’t even know it.
